Join professional birder Kevin Burke for a birding exploration of Holmes Educational State Forest. Kevin has been birding for 17 years and uses his expertise to guide trips in North Carolina, Tennessee, Washington, Idaho, and Oregon. Most recently Kevin has led trips to Columbia and Portugal. On this hike we can expect to see/hear warblers (such as Ovenbird, Black-throated Green Warbler, Hooded Warbler, Louisiana Waterthrush, and Northern Parula), tanagers (Scarlet) and vireos (Red-eyed and Blue-headed) among others.
